Electrical Characteristics
LVDS Receiver DC Specifications
Over recommended operating supply and temperature range unless otherwise specified
Symbol
Parameter
Conditions
Min
Typ*
Max
Unit
VTH
Differential Input High
Threshold
RL=100Ω, VIC=+1.2V
-
-
100
mV
VTL
Differential Input Low
Threshold
-100
-
-
mV
IIN
Input Current
VIN=+2.4 / 0V
LVDS VCC=3.6V
-
-
30
A
Table 6. LVDS Receiver DC Specifications
LVCMOS DC Specifications
Over recommended operating supply and temperature range unless otherwise specified
Symbol
Parameter
Conditions
Min
Typ
Max
Unit
VIH
High Level Input Voltage
-
2.0
-
VCC
V
VIL
Low Level Input Voltage
-
GND
-
0.8
V
VOH
High Level Output Voltage
IOH=-4mA (Data)
IOH=-8mA (Clock)
2.4
-
-
V
VOL
Low Level Output Voltage
IOL=4mA (Data)
IOL=8mA (Clock)
-
-
0.4
V
IIN
Input Current
GND
 V
IN  VCC
-
-
10
A
Table 7. LVCMOS DC Specifications
